1999 Ford F-250 Super Duty XLT SuperCab 4x4
Here’s a truck that brings the right combination of old-school Ford toughness, classic styling, and useful upgrades. This 1999 Ford F-250 Super Duty XLT SuperCab 4x4 is finished in the distinctive Island Blue Clearcoat Metallic and has just 117,815 actual miles on the odometer.
Under the hood is Ford’s 5.4L Triton V8, paired with four-wheel drive for the kind of capability that made these trucks such dependable workhorses. The SuperCab configuration gives you the added versatility of extra interior space without giving up the utility of a full-size pickup.
This F-250 has also been given a handful of tasteful upgrades, including a 3-inch lift riding on aggressive Dick Cepek Radial F-C II tires, giving it a tougher stance while maintaining the classic look of a late-’90s Super Duty. An aftermarket chrome grille adds some extra shine up front, while chrome tailpipes finish off the rear with a little attitude.
For towing and hauling duty, it is equipped with a Tekonsha trailer brake controller, while the pickup bed features a Rhino Liner and tonneau cover for added protection and practicality.
